    Default Thunderer Mach IV tire

    Has anyone heard of the Thunderer tires? I was searching for info for a replacement for the rear Arachnid tire in a 205/55R15 size. Came across this tire and it was under $48.00 delivered. Got to be garbage, right. I did more investigation and looked up some reviews from a couple of other websites. As far as dry adhesion, wet adhesion, and mileage, all the reviews were 4 1/2 - 5 stars. V speed rated (149 mph), and 500AA. For a car, they have a 60,000 mile warranty. Too good to be true?

    I have Thunderer Mach I on the front on my 2012 RTL . I put them on at a little over 20,000 miles and the Spyder now has 53,000+ miles on it and the tires are still going strong. Should last at least another season if not more. I ride a lot of miles and though I usually ride solo I do ride hard. I think for an economy brand Thunderer makes a very good tire and in looking at your Mach IV it has a UIQC rating of 420AA. Wet traction is supposed to be very good. There is not much wet to ride in out here in Utah but what little I have encountered the Mach I's on the front have been good.
